What is CVE-2018-19242?

A buffer overflow vulnerability exists in apply.cgi on specific TRENDnet devices, enabling attackers to manipulate control flow by sending specially crafted POST request payloads. This flaw occurs during the processing of user-supplied input, which can lead to unauthorized access and potential control over the device, posing significant security risks.
